Understanding Subwoofer Basics
Before we dive into the direction of the subwoofer, it’s essential to understand how it works. A subwoofer is a specialized speaker designed to produce low-frequency sounds, typically below 80 Hz. These low frequencies are responsible for the rumble and vibration that add depth to music and movies. Subwoofers work by using a woofer driver, an amplifier, and a cabinet to produce sound waves.
Types Of Subwoofers
There are two primary types of subwoofers: passive and active. Passive subwoofers require an external amplifier to function, while active subwoofers have a built-in amplifier. The type of subwoofer you have may affect the direction it should face, as we’ll discuss later.

How Do I Determine The Optimal Direction For My Subwoofer?
Determining the optimal direction for your subwoofer involves a combination of experimentation and measurement. One way to start is to place the subwoofer in a corner of the room and listen to some music or a movie. Pay attention to the bass response and see if it sounds even and well-defined.
You can also use a sound level meter or a subwoofer calibration tool to measure the frequency response and identify any areas of uneven bass response. By moving the subwoofer to different locations and taking measurements, you can determine the optimal direction for your subwoofer and make adjustments as needed.
Can I Use Multiple Subwoofers To Improve The Bass Response?
Yes, using multiple subwoofers can be an effective way to improve the bass response in a home theater system. By placing multiple subwoofers in different locations, you can create a more even and immersive bass response. This is especially useful in larger rooms or rooms with complex acoustics.
When using multiple subwoofers, it’s essential to calibrate them properly to ensure that they are working together in phase. This can involve adjusting the phase control on each subwoofer and experimenting with different placement options. By using multiple subwoofers, you can create a more engaging and immersive listening experience.
